Question:

Sayali voted for her employee and convinced her friends, and family to vote for him. She is aware that he is a rude and dishonest man. The discomfort Sayali feels can best be explained by __________.

Options:

Self-fulfilling prophecy

Two-step concept

Theory of Cognitive dissonance

Balance theory

Correct Answer:

Theory of Cognitive dissonance

Explanation:
 The correct answer is Theory of Cognitive dissonance.

Cognitive dissonance is a state of tension that occurs when a person holds two or more conflicting cognitions (beliefs, thoughts, or opinions). In this case, Sayali's cognition that she voted for a rude and dishonest man is dissonant with her cognition that she is a good person. To reduce this dissonance, Sayali may experience discomfort or guilt.
